關於jpa的查詢 在網上能查到的資料太有限了 今天自己遇到的問題 記錄下 JPA 動態查詢語句 多表關聯后 就會有重復的問題,這是我們不想看到的,自定義sql的時候可以通過group by ,distinct來解決 JPA中也是如此,只是不知道寫在什么地方 如何來 ...
很多人新手對於數據庫distinct 的用法有誤解接下來我們看一段代碼: 數據表:tableid name a b c c b 我們使用distinct來去重name是這樣: select distinct name from table 結果為: a b c 可是一般數據庫去重都是需要不止一個字段接下來看這個: select distinct name, id from table 多了個id效 ...
2017-09-15 11:21 0 1581 推薦指數:
關於jpa的查詢 在網上能查到的資料太有限了 今天自己遇到的問題 記錄下 JPA 動態查詢語句 多表關聯后 就會有重復的問題,這是我們不想看到的,自定義sql的時候可以通過group by ,distinct來解決 JPA中也是如此,只是不知道寫在什么地方 如何來 ...
多表關聯去重查詢 ...
好久沒有寫SQL語句的多表連接查詢,總在用框架進行持久化操作。今天寫了一個多表關聯查詢,想根據兩個字段唯一確定一條數據 失敗的案例如下: 查詢出來的效果,簡直不忍直視。 被改良后,使用join on 【inner join on】關聯多表查詢 ...
--處理表重復記錄(查詢和刪除)/********************************************************************* ...
sql去重 現在有一張表t(id,name),id是主鍵,name可以重復,現在要刪除重復數據,保留id最小的數據。請寫出SQL。 表:t id name 1 張三 2 張三 3 李四 4 李四 ...
1、單個字段 查詢所有重復數據 select * from ActivityWinUser where (UID) in(select UID from ActivityWinUser group by UID having count(*)>1); 去重 delete from ...
現在有一張表t(id,name),id是主鍵,name可以重復,現在要刪除重復數據,保留id最小的數據。請寫出SQL。 表:t id name 1 張三 2 張三 3 李四 4 李四 5 李四 分析 ...
SQL數據庫中的表連接 含義:連接即是把兩個表或者兩個以上的表信息放置在一個結果集中 分類: 1.內部連接 2.外部連接 3.完全連接 4.交叉連接 內部連接是連接類型中最普通的一種,與大多數連接一樣,內部連接根據一個或幾個相同的字段將記錄匹配 ...